#ifndef __DEV_TC_TCVAR_H__
#define __DEV_TC_TCVAR_H__

/*
* Definitions for TURBOchannel autoconfiguration.
*/

#include <sys/bus.h>
#include <sys/device.h>
#include <dev/tc/tcreg.h>

/*
* Machine-dependent definitions.
*/
#include <machine/tc_machdep.h>

/*
* In the long run, the following block will go completely away.
* For now, the MI TC code still uses the old TC_IPL_ names
* and not the new IPL_ names.
*/
#if 1
/*
* Map the new definitions to the old.
*/
#include <sys/intr.h>

#define tc_intrlevel_t  int

#define TC_IPL_NONE     IPL_NONE
#define TC_IPL_BIO      IPL_BIO
#define TC_IPL_NET      IPL_NET
#define TC_IPL_TTY      IPL_TTY
#define TC_IPL_CLOCK    IPL_CLOCK
#endif /* 1 */

struct tc_softc {
       device_t sc_dev;

       int     sc_speed;
       int     sc_nslots;
       const struct tc_slotdesc *sc_slots;
       uint32_t sc_slots_used;

       const struct evcnt *(*sc_intr_evcnt)(device_t, void *);
       void    (*sc_intr_establish)(device_t, void *,
                       int, int (*)(void *), void *);
       void    (*sc_intr_disestablish)(device_t, void *);
       bus_dma_tag_t (*sc_get_dma_tag)(int);
};

/*
* Arguments used to attach TURBOchannel busses.
*/
struct tcbus_attach_args {
       const char              *tba_busname;   /* XXX should be common */
       bus_space_tag_t tba_memt;

       /* Bus information */
       u_int           tba_speed;              /* see TC_SPEED_* below */
       u_int           tba_nslots;
       const struct tc_slotdesc *tba_slots;
       u_int           tba_nbuiltins;
       const struct tc_builtin *tba_builtins;


       /* TC bus resource management; XXX will move elsewhere eventually. */
       const struct evcnt *(*tba_intr_evcnt)(device_t, void *);
       void    (*tba_intr_establish)(device_t, void *,
                       int, int (*)(void *), void *);
       void    (*tba_intr_disestablish)(device_t, void *);
       bus_dma_tag_t (*tba_get_dma_tag)(int);
};

/*
* Arguments used to attach TURBOchannel devices.
*/
struct tc_attach_args {
       bus_space_tag_t ta_memt;
       bus_dma_tag_t   ta_dmat;

       char            ta_modname[TC_ROM_LLEN+1];
       u_int           ta_slot;
       tc_offset_t     ta_offset;
       tc_addr_t       ta_addr;
       void            *ta_cookie;
       u_int           ta_busspeed;            /* see TC_SPEED_* below */
};

/*
* Description of TURBOchannel slots, provided by machine-dependent
* code to the TURBOchannel bus driver.
*/
struct tc_slotdesc {
       tc_addr_t       tcs_addr;
       void            *tcs_cookie;
};

/*
* Description of built-in TURBOchannel devices, provided by
* machine-dependent code to the TURBOchannel bus driver.
*/
struct tc_builtin {
       const char      *tcb_modname;
       u_int           tcb_slot;
       tc_offset_t     tcb_offset;
       void            *tcb_cookie;
};

/*
* Interrupt establishment functions.
*/
int     tc_checkslot(tc_addr_t, char *, struct tc_rommap **);
void    tcattach(device_t, device_t, void *);
const struct evcnt *tc_intr_evcnt(device_t, void *);
void    tc_intr_establish(device_t, void *, int, int (*)(void *),
           void *);
void    tc_intr_disestablish(device_t, void *);

/*
* Miscellaneous definitions.
*/
#define TC_SPEED_12_5_MHZ       0               /* 12.5MHz TC bus */
#define TC_SPEED_25_MHZ         1               /* 25MHz TC bus */

#endif /* __DEV_TC_TCVAR_H__ */
